diff --git a/docs/CommandGuide/llvm-ar.pod b/docs/CommandGuide/llvm-ar.pod index ecfb80a3d9..99fdcb979c 100644 --- a/docs/CommandGuide/llvm-ar.pod +++ b/docs/CommandGuide/llvm-ar.pod @@ -269,6 +269,16 @@ what is being done. =back +=head1 STANDARDS + +The B<llvm-ar> utility is intended to provide a superset of the IEEE Std 1003.2 +(POSIX.2) functionality for C<ar>. B<llvm-ar> can read both SVR4 and BSD4.4 (or +Mac OS X) archives. If the C<f> modifier is given to the C<x> or C<r> operations +then B<llvm-ar> will write SVR4 compatible archives. Without this modifier, +B<llvm-ar> will write BSD4.4 compatible archives that have long names +immediately after the header and indicated using the "#1/ddd" notation for the +name in the header. + =head1 FILE FORMAT The file format for LLVM Archive files is similar to that of BSD 4.4 or Mac OSX |
